"Pirlinyanu Site - Water Dreaming" by Julie Nangala Robinson is a delicate, small-scale painting that offers an aerial perspective of an important Water Dreaming site linked to her father's traditional country of Pirlinyanu. This rocky outcrop, located in the Tanami Desert west of Yuendumu and near the WA border, holds significant cultural value.

The painting pairs beautifully with its sister piece, Catalogue 11165JR, both set against a striking white background. Julie's work, celebrated for its extraordinary optical brilliance, showcases her skillful use of varying dot sizes and the meticulous construction of shapes and reference points through repeated dotting.

In August 2023, Julie Nangala Robinson was honored with the Telstra Aboriginal Art Award for Best Painting, recognizing her artistic excellence. Her depiction of Ngapa Jukurrpa (Water Dreaming) reflects deep traditional knowledge, illustrating the rain's movement over the rocky outcrop and the crucial rock holes that provide water in this arid landscape.

Julie, the eldest of Dorothy Napangardi Robinson's five daughters, recently corrected the spelling of her surname to Robertson. She believes her father, Windy, misspelled it, aligning her name with her relatives in Yuendumu. Windy Robinson had two wives, Rene and Dorothy, making this adjustment a tribute to family heritage and accuracy.
